"The build-your-own poke bowls at this quick-service spot in the Lower Haight come with your choice of six different proteins, and a bunch of colorful toppings like pickled ginger, seaweed salad, masago, and crunchy garbanzo beans. For the chronically indecisive, they also have a few signature bowls - we like the Makai bowl with ahi tuna, salmon, shoyu, and spicy aioli, or the Wasabi Salmon bowl." - Julia Chen 1
